1. Sales pop-up Instagram
If your company is not on Instagram, you should consider that. The independent business owners can offer products of Direct-to-consumer in seconds by taking a picture and post it along with a price, to your network social. Thus, even a one person operation can generate sales through media social. Small brick and mortar operations can also use this method to reach a wider than they might be able to locally audience. You do not have those bases its business model on Instagram. Try offering excess flash sales through photos.
2. Facebook coupons “members only”
Facebook is probably the platform social most used among enterprises, but many of these companies are not sure how to use Facebook to win more customers. Try offering members-only coupons codes that promise a discount to loyal followers. If you offer significant coupons, you can upgrade directly relationships and drive sales. Is likely to also pick up some new customers in the process.
3. Campaigns on Kickstarter
Kickstarter can not be considered to be a social media platform, but do not overlook its potential as a tool for generating sales. Game companies in particular have discovered they can use the pedal to start , along with his other tools of social media to generate sales of a game before they develop. Then have a return committed to invest up front, something almost unheard of for small businesses. It’s a great way to test the market before committing significant funds for production and advertising.
4. Walking in Blogs
Some niches have already begun to harness the power of bloggers in the movement of theirproducts . With a little research up front, is a group of bloggers who are willing to offer their product in the course of a few days or weeks. Some PR firms are even beginning to offer this service as part of its package of media social. Not every business model lends itself to a campaign blogger, but if your products or services seem to fit, especially if your company has its own blog, this can be a powerful way to generate sales at minimal cost.
5. Contests Twitter
Smart companies have turned Twitter into a moneymaker making their followers of the creative process. Stores Mom and Dad can ask their fan base to vote on designs products, color schemes and slogans to generate interest. Ultimately, the consumer feels involved enough in the goods to buy.
